Take your Fedora Linux Skills to the Next LevelImportant. WVD was first announced by Microsoft in September 2018, available as a public. It is aimed at enterprise customers rather than at individual users. Azure Virtual Desktop (AVD), formerly known as Windows Virtual Desktop (WVD), is a Microsoft Azure-based system for virtualizing its Windows operating systems, providing virtualized desktops and applications in the cloud (over the Internet).Learn more.It also shows you how to use some PowerShell commands in Windows Server 2012 R2 Server Core. When using the VNC display, you must use the -k parameter to set the keyboard layout if you are not using en-us.Fedora 31 Essentials book is now available in Print ($36.99) and eBook ($24.99) editions. With the -vnc option option, you can have QEMU listen on VNC display display and redirect the VGA display over the VNC session. Normally, QEMU (/usr/libexec/qemu-kvm) uses SDL to display the VGA output. If you're using Azure Virtual Desktop (classic) without Azure Resource Manager objects, see this article.Method 1: Command Line Option.Some of these command-line options are mandatory (specifically name, ram and disk storage must be provided) while others are optional. For details on these requirements read Installing and Configuring Fedora KVM Virtualization.Running virt-install to Build the KVM Guest SystemVirt-install must be run as root and accepts a wide range of command-line arguments that are used to provide configuration information related to the virtual machine being created. Whilst most users will probably stay with the graphical virt-mamager tool, virt-install has the advantage that virtual machines can be created when access to a graphical desktop is not available, or when creation needs to be automated in a script.This chapter assumes that the necessary KVM tools are installed and that the system was rebooted after these were installed. In this chapter we will turn our attention to the creation of KVM guest operating system using the virt-install command-line tool.The virt-install tool is supplied to allow new virtual machines to be created by providing a list of command-line options. In the previous chapter we explored the creation and management of KVM guest operating systems using the virt-manager graphical tool.
-arch=ARCH Request a non-native CPU architecture for the guest virtual machine. If the hypervisor does not have enough free memory, it is usual for it to automatically take memory away from the host operating system to satisfy this allocation. -r MEMORY, -ram=MEMORY Memory to allocate for guest instance in megabytes. To re-define an existing guest, use the virsh(1) tool to shut it down (’virsh shutdown’) & delete (’virsh undefine’) it prior to running "virt-install". This must be unique amongst all guests known to the hypervisor on the connection, including those not currently active. -n NAME, -name=NAME Name of the new guest virtual machine instance. Samsung android usb driver for mac osIf you specify UUID, you should use a 32-digit hexadecimal number. -u UUID, -uuid=UUID UUID for the guest if none is given a random UUID will be generated. If omitted, the host CPU architecture will be used in the guest. ![]() This will attempt to pick the most suitable ACPI & APIC settings, optimally supported mouse drivers, virtio, and generally accommodate other operating system quirks. -os-type=OS_TYPE Optimize the guest configuration for a type of operating system (ex. If the value ’auto’ is passed, virt-install attempts to automatically determine an optimal cpu pinning using NUMA data, if available. For a full list of valid options refer to the man page ( man virt-install). This parameter is optional, and does not require an "-os-type" to be specified. -os-variant=OS_VARIANT Further optimize the guest configuration for a specific operating system variant (ex. For a full list of valid options refer to the man page ( man virt-install). Virtual Desktop Client For Kvm Full Virtualization Only-v, -hvm Request the use of full virtualization, if both para & full virtualization are available on the host. (Full virtualization only). -noacpi Override the OS type / variant to disables the ACPI setting for fully virtualized guest. (Full virtualization only). -sound Attach a virtual audio device to the guest. HOSTDEV is a node device name as used by libvirt (as shown by ’virsh nodedev-list’). Use of this option is recommended unless a guest OS is known to be incompatible with the accelerators. -accelerate When installing a QEMU guest, make use of the KVM or KQEMU kernel acceleration capabilities if available. If the host supports both para & full virtualization, and neither this parameter nor the "-hvm" are specified, this will be assumed. -p, -paravirt This guest should be a paravirtualized guest. This parameter is implied if connecting to a QEMU based hypervisor. If a cdrom has been specified via the "-disk" option, and neither "-cdrom" nor any other install option is specified, the "-disk" cdrom is used as the install media. The URLs take the same format as described for the "-location" argument. It can also be a URL from which to fetch/access a minimal boot ISO image. It can be path to an ISO image, or to a CDROM device. -c CDROM, -cdrom=CDROM File or device use as a virtual CD-ROM device for fully virtualized guests. -import Skip the OS installation process, and build a guest around an existing disk image. ftp://host/path - An FTP server location containing an installable distribution image -pxe Use the PXE boot protocol to load the initial ramdisk and kernel for starting the guest installation process. - An HTTP server location containing an installable distribution image nfs:host:/path or nfs://host/path - An NFS server location containing an installable distribution DIRECTORY - Path to a local directory containing an installable distribution image The "LOCATION" can take one of the following forms: ![]() For remote hosts, the base directory is required to be a storage pool if using this method. If the base directory of the path is a libvirt storage pool on the host, the new storage will be created as a libvirt storage volume. Specifying a non-existent path implies attempting to create the new storage, and will require specifyng a ’size’ value. If installing on a remote host, the existing media must be shared as a libvirt storage volume. Existing media can be a file or block device. Value can be ’cdrom’, ’disk’, or ’floppy’. device - Disk device type. This is specified as ’poolname/volname’. vol - An existing libvirt storage volume to use. Requires specifying a ’size’ value. ![]() The host pagecache provides cache memory. cache - The cache mode to be used. Thus use of this option is recommended to ensure consistently high performance and to avoid I/O errors in the guest should the host filesystem fill up. The initial time taken to fully-allocate the guest virtual disk (spare=false) will be usually by balanced by faster install times inside the guest. Default is ’true’ (do not fully allocate). See the examples section for some uses. ’writeback’ provides read and write caching. ’writethrough’ provides read caching. This is deprecated in favor of "-disk". -s DISKSIZE, -file-size=DISKSIZE Size of the file to create for the guest virtual disk. This option is deprecated in favor of "-disk". -f DISKFILE, -file=DISKFILE Path to the file, disk partition, or logical volume to use as the backing store for the guest’s virtual disk. Also use this if live migration will be used with this guest. Use this option if the host has static networking config & the guest requires full outbound and inbound connectivity to/from the LAN. bridge:BRIDGE - Connect to a bridge device in the host called "BRIDGE". The value for "NETWORK" can take one of 3 formats: -w NETWORK, -network=NETWORK Connect the guest to the host network. This is deprecated in favort of "-disk" -nodisks Request a virtual machine without any local disk storage, typically used for running ’Live CD’ images or installing to network storage (iSCSI or NFS root).
0 Comments
Leave a Reply. |
AuthorRocki ArchivesCategories |